REWARD FOR DISCOVERY OF NEW GOLDFIELDS.

Amended Conditions. 1. Thk maximum sum offered as a reward for any proved discovery of a new goldliold in accordance with these conditions is £5,000 for tho North Island, and £5,000 for the Middle Island. 2. Tiie newly-discovered gddfield must be situated not loss than forty miles from any existing proldfield or any existing workings. 3." No reward shall be payable until 50,000 ounces of gold have been produced from the newly-discovered goldfield within three years from tho date of its being registered. •1. Any person discovering new gold-work-ings, and being desirous of obtaining the reward, shall immediately forward a written report of such discovery, with full particulars, to the Warden or Resident Magistrate of the district within which such discovery Bhall be situated, and the Warden or Resident Magistrate shall forthwith register the report as an application for reward.

5. No prospecting will be allowed upon Native land without a prospecting license authorising the person therein named, with the consent of the owner of the land, to prospect, in accordance with the provisions of sections one hundred and thirty fivo to one hundred and thirty seven of " Tho Mining A.ct, ISSG " inclusive. No reward shall be paid for any discjvory that may bo made upon Native land without the consent of the Native owners and the approval of tho Minister of Mines.—N.Z. (iazette.
